



jPersist is an extremely powerful object-relational database persistence API that manages to avoid the need for configuration and annotation; mapping is automatic.
DBVA for Eclipse, a sophisticated Object to Relational mapping designer and code generator. DBVA-EC generates real executable persistence code, persistence layer and database, which through a simple visual modeling process.
DBVA for IntelliJ IDEA, a sophisticated Object to Relational mapping designer and code generator. DBVA-IJ generates real executable persistence code, persistence layer and database, which through a simple visual modeling process.
DBVA for JBuilder, a sophisticated Object to Relational mapping designer and code generator. DBVA-JB generates real executable persistence code, persistence layer and database, which through a simple visual modeling process.

DBVA for JDeveloper for Windows
$699 - Visual Paradigm International Ltd.
DBVA for JDeveloper, a sophisticated Object to Relational mapping designer and code generator to you. DBVA-JD generate real executable persistence code, persistence layer and database (DDL or direct execute to the database). You can focus on developing business logic and user interface without care about the database issue. The persistence layer of the DBVA-JD is build on top of the most popular persistence layer, Hibernate.
There is no vendor lock on when adopting DBVA-JD. All generated code can run on all popular relational database (e.g. MySQL, Oralce, SQL Server, DB2) and Application Server (e.g. JBoss, WebLogic Server ....). To know more about how DBVA-JD can help, please visit the Java ORM resource page at
You can use DBVA-JD to:
+Design your object model by UML Class Diagram
+Design your database by Entity Relational Database (ERD)
+Generate Class Diagram from ERD
+Generate ERD from Class Diagram
+Generate POJO, DAO, Factory, Static method style persistence Java code
+Generate Database Schema (DDL)
+Reverse engineering of ERD from DDL
+Support Stored Procedure and Database Trigger (New Feature)
+Generate Hibernate annotations in ORM persistence
+Generate Hibernate version tag for optimistic concurrency control
+Shape editor
+Bookmark (New Feature)
+Handi-Selection (New Feature)
+Command-line operations (New Feature)
+Modeling collaboratively with VP Teamwork Server, CVS and Subversion (Enhanced)
+Interoperability with UML2 model (UML2.x metamodel for eclipse platform) through XMI
+Export diagrams to JPG, PNG, SVG, EMF, PDF
and more.....
DBVA-JD home page:
DBVA-JD Quick Tour:
Programmer's Guide for Java:
Screen shot:

DBVA for NetBeans for Windows
$699 - Visual Paradigm International Ltd.
DBVA for NetBeans, a sophisticated Object to Relational mapping designer and code generator to you. DBVA-NB generate real executable persistence code, persistence layer and database (DDL or direct execute to the database). You can focus on developing business logic and user interface without care about the database issue. The persistence layer of the DBVA-NB is build on top of the most popular persistence layer, Hibernate.
There is no vendor lock on when adopting DBVA-NB. All generated code can run on all popular relational database (e.g. MySQL, Oralce, SQL Server, DB2) and Application Server (e.g. JBoss, WebLogic Server ....). To know more about how DBVA-NB can help, please visit the Java ORM resource page at
You can use DBVA-NB to:
+Design your object model by UML Class Diagram
+Design your database by Entity Relational Database (ERD)
+Generate Class Diagram from ERD
+Generate ERD from Class Diagram
+Generate POJO, DAO, Factory, Static method style persistence Java code
+Generate Database Schema (DDL)
+Reverse engineering of ERD from DDL
+Support Stored Procedure and Database Trigger (New Feature)
+Generate Hibernate annotations in ORM persistence
+Generate Hibernate version tag for optimistic concurrency control
+Shape editor
+Bookmark (New Feature)
+Handi-Selection (New Feature)
+Command-line operations (New Feature)
+Modeling collaboratively with VP Teamwork Server, CVS and Subversion (Enhanced)
+Interoperability with UML2 model (UML2.x metamodel for eclipse platform) through XMI
+Export diagrams to JPG, PNG, SVG, EMF, PDF
and more.....
DBVA-NB home page:
DBVA-NB Quick Tour:
Programmer's Guide for Java:
Screen shot:

DBVA for WebLogic Workshop for Windows
$699 - Visual Paradigm International Ltd.
DBVA for WebLogic Workshop, a sophisticated Object to Relational mapping designer and code generator to you. DBVA-WW generate real executable persistence code, persistence layer and database (DDL or direct execute to the database). You can focus on developing business logic and user interface without care about the database issue. The persistence layer of the DBVA-WW is build on top of the most popular persistence layer, Hibernate.
There is no vendor lock on when adopting DBVA-WW. All generated code can run on all popular relational database (e.g. MySQL, Oralce, SQL Server, DB2) and Application Server (e.g. JBoss, WebLogic Server ....). To know more about how DBVA-WW can help, please visit the Java ORM resource page at
You can use DBVA-WW to:
+Design your object model by UML Class Diagram
+Design your database by Entity Relational Database (ERD)
+Generate Class Diagram from ERD
+Generate ERD from Class Diagram
+Generate POJO, DAO, Factory, Static method style persistence Java code
+Generate Database Schema (DDL)
+Reverse engineering of ERD from DDL
+Support Stored Procedure and Database Trigger (New Feature)
+Generate Hibernate annotations in ORM persistence
+Generate Hibernate version tag for optimistic concurrency control
+Shape editor
+Bookmark (New Feature)
+Handi-Selection (New Feature)
+Command-line operations (New Feature)
+Modeling collaboratively with VP Teamwork Server, CVS and Subversion (Enhanced)
+Interoperability with UML2 model (UML2.x metamodel for eclipse platform) through XMI
+Export diagrams to JPG, PNG, SVG, EMF, PDF
and more.....
DBVA-WW home page:
DBVA-WW Quick Tour:
Programmer's Guide for Java:
Screen shot:

DB Visual ARCHITECT for Windows
$699 - Visual Paradigm International Ltd.
DB Visual ARCHITECT, a sophisticated Object to Relational mapping designer and code generator to you. DB-VA generate real executable persistence code, persistence layer and database (DDL or direct execute to the database). You can focus on developing business logic and user interface without care about the database issue. The persistence layer of the DB-VA is build on top of the most popular persistence layer, Hibernate.
There is no vendor lock on when adopting DB-VA. All generated code can run on all popular relational database (e.g. MySQL, Oralce, SQL Server, DB2) and Application Server (e.g. JBoss, WebLogic Server ...). To know more about how DB-VA can help, please visit the Java ORM resource page at
You can use DB-VA to:
+Design your object model by UML Class Diagram
+Design your database by Entity Relational Database (ERD)
+Generate Class Diagram from ERD
+Generate ERD from Class Diagram
+Generate POJO, DAO, Factory, Static method style persistence Java code
+Generate Database Schema (DDL)
+Reverse engineering of ERD from DDL
+Support Stored Procedure and Database Trigger (New Feature)
+Generate Hibernate annotations in ORM persistence
+Generate Hibernate version tag for optimistic concurrency control
+Create table directly from dialog box
+Shape editor
+Bookmark (New Feature)
+Handi-Selection (New Feature)
+Command-line operations (New Feature)
+Modeling collaboratively with VP Teamwork Server, CVS and Subversion (Enhanced)
+Interoperability with UML2 model (UML2.x metamodel for eclipse platform) through XMI
+Export diagrams to JPG, PNG, SVG, EMF, PDF
and more.
DB-VA home page:
DB-VA Quick Tour:
Programmer's Guide for Java:
Screen shot:

TierDeveloper
$1495 - AlachiSoft
TierDeveloper 5.6 is the industry standard for Object to Relational mapping and code generation tool that helps you rapidly design, generate and deploy middle-tier-objects for your enterprise applications. It is designed to enable developers to build BUSINESS FRAMEWORKS with an instant increase in productivity and at the same time greatly simplifying the management of change.
- .NET Framework 2.0 Support
- Visual Studio .NET 2005 Integration
- New Mapping Wizard provided to do N-N Mapping
- Seperation of Domain Object from Persistence Layer
- Custom hooks in a seperate independent .NET Assembly
- Integration Layer provided
- .NET components
- ASP.NET pages
- XML/XSLT
- Web Services
- C# and VB.NET
- Supports OLEDB, SqlDB and OraDB Data Providers
- Object Binding
- Lazy Loading
- Web Services
- BEA WebLogic
- IBM WebSphere
- Oracle 9iAS
Database Support
- SQL Server 7.0/2000/2005
- Oracle 8i/9i/10g
- IBM DB2 7.1/8.1
- Ms Access 2000 or later

Altova DatabaseSpy
$129 - Altova, Inc.
Altova DatabaseSpy 2008 is the unique multi-database data management, query, and design tool from the creators of XMLSpy. DatabaseSpy connects to all major databases, easing SQL editing and database structure design, for a fraction of the cost of single-database solutions. DatabaseSpy provides a straightforward database connection wizard and organizes connections and related project files to make accessing your databases and their components effortless. You can even open connections to multiple databases at once. It clearly presents tables, views, stored procedures, and data in easily negotiable windows, and it also lets you directly edit database content. DatabaseSpy's SQL Editor facilitates query writing with capabilities like code completion, syntax coloring, drag & drop editing, and more. You can easily write SQL scripts that retrieve data from multiple tables, and results can be displayed in individual, named windows for maximum clarity. DatabaseSpy's powerful Database Design Editor enables graphical design and visualization of database structures or schemas. You can also use it to duplicate existing structures in differing database types. DatabaseSpy supports IBM DB2 (including IBM pureXML databases), Microsoft SQL Server, Microsoft Access, Oracle, MySQL, and Sybase, as well as other ADO or ODBC databases. XML support includes advanced capabilities to inspect XML data in database tables and to manage the XML Schemas used to validate that data. It exports data in five formats, including XML, XML Structure, CSV, HTML, and Excel, and it imports data from CSV files. With all this capability and more, DatabaseSpy is sure to save you time, simplify your work, and ensure accuracy for all your data. It is the one tool to finally liberate data management. Do data differently! Download Altova DatabaseSpy 2008 today, and try it free for 30 days.
© 2007-2008 Software Institute
Software Institute periodically updates pricing and product information from third-party sources,
so some information may be slightly out-of-date. You should confirm all information before relying on it.